Review Historical Market Leaders

Some of the best educational opportunities come from studying stocks that have already completed significant trends.

Ask yourself:

  • What did the market structure look like?
  • How did accumulation develop?
  • How many resistance touches occurred?
  • Were higher lows visible?
  • Could EdgeBreak have identified this earlier?

Reviewing historical examples helps reinforce concepts without the pressure of live markets.

Learn From Both Successes and Failures

Some of your greatest learning opportunities will come from charts that never develop into successful breakouts.

Continue reviewing both successful and unsuccessful examples objectively.

Every chart provides valuable information that strengthens your understanding of how markets behave.

Stay Curious

Curiosity is one of the most valuable qualities a market researcher can develop.

Continue asking questions.

  • Why did this structure develop?
  • What changed?
  • What characteristics appeared first?
  • How does this compare with previous examples?

Curiosity encourages deeper understanding and supports continual improvement.
